Home
last modified time | relevance | path

Searched refs:handler_data (Results 1 – 3 of 3) sorted by relevance

/arch/sparc/kernel/
Dsun4m_irq.c191 struct sun4m_handler_data *handler_data; in sun4m_mask_irq() local
194 handler_data = irq_data_get_irq_handler_data(data); in sun4m_mask_irq()
195 if (handler_data->mask) { in sun4m_mask_irq()
199 if (handler_data->percpu) { in sun4m_mask_irq()
200 sbus_writel(handler_data->mask, &sun4m_irq_percpu[cpu]->set); in sun4m_mask_irq()
202 sbus_writel(handler_data->mask, &sun4m_irq_global->mask_set); in sun4m_mask_irq()
210 struct sun4m_handler_data *handler_data; in sun4m_unmask_irq() local
213 handler_data = irq_data_get_irq_handler_data(data); in sun4m_unmask_irq()
214 if (handler_data->mask) { in sun4m_unmask_irq()
218 if (handler_data->percpu) { in sun4m_unmask_irq()
[all …]
Dsun4d_irq.c191 struct sun4d_handler_data *handler_data = irq_data_get_irq_handler_data(data); in sun4d_mask_irq() local
194 int cpuid = handler_data->cpuid; in sun4d_mask_irq()
197 real_irq = handler_data->real_irq; in sun4d_mask_irq()
209 struct sun4d_handler_data *handler_data = irq_data_get_irq_handler_data(data); in sun4d_unmask_irq() local
212 int cpuid = handler_data->cpuid; in sun4d_unmask_irq()
215 real_irq = handler_data->real_irq; in sun4d_unmask_irq()
292 struct sun4d_handler_data *handler_data; in _sun4d_build_device_irq() local
302 handler_data = irq_get_handler_data(irq); in _sun4d_build_device_irq()
303 if (unlikely(handler_data)) in _sun4d_build_device_irq()
306 handler_data = kzalloc(sizeof(struct sun4d_handler_data), GFP_ATOMIC); in _sun4d_build_device_irq()
[all …]
Dirq_64.c373 struct irq_handler_data *handler_data; in sun4u_irq_enable() local
375 handler_data = irq_data_get_irq_handler_data(data); in sun4u_irq_enable()
376 if (likely(handler_data)) { in sun4u_irq_enable()
382 imap = handler_data->imap; in sun4u_irq_enable()
391 upa_writeq(ICLR_IDLE, handler_data->iclr); in sun4u_irq_enable()
398 struct irq_handler_data *handler_data; in sun4u_set_affinity() local
400 handler_data = irq_data_get_irq_handler_data(data); in sun4u_set_affinity()
401 if (likely(handler_data)) { in sun4u_set_affinity()
406 imap = handler_data->imap; in sun4u_set_affinity()
415 upa_writeq(ICLR_IDLE, handler_data->iclr); in sun4u_set_affinity()
[all …]